AI Summary
- Removes the current exclusion of sexual orientation and gender identity from affirmative action requirements in New Jersey public works contracts
- Requires contractors and subcontractors on state, county, and municipal public works projects to include LGBTQ+ individuals in their affirmative action programs approved by the State Treasurer
- Mandates that bid specifications and contract provisions include non-discrimination language covering sexual orientation and gender identity for recruitment, hiring, and employment practices
- Amends P.L.1975, c.127 to eliminate language that previously required only equal employment opportunity (not affirmative action) for LGBTQ+ workers
- Takes effect 120 days after enactment, with the State Treasurer authorized to take preparatory administrative action beforehand
